What is 8(1/4x-3)+24<4(x+5)

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 01-09-2018

Hey there!

We can solve inequalities just like equations. There is only one difference though. If you ever multiply or divide both sides by a negative number, you "flip" the inequality sign.

First, let's undo the parentheses.

2x-24+24<4x+20

We simplify.

2x<4x+20

We subtract 4x from both sides.

-2x<20

We divide both sides by -2 (we will need to flip the inequality sign).

x>-10
